Definitions of afternoon

afternoon is defined as:

Definition 1 as noun

  • noun
    The part of the day from noon or lunchtime until sunset, evening, or suppertime or 6pm.
  • noun
    The later part of anything, often with implications of decline.
  • noun
    A party or social event held in the afternoon.

Definition 1 as adverb

  • adverb
    (more often in the plural) In the afternoon.

Definition 1 as interjection

  • interjection
    Clipping of good afternoon.

What is hyphenation

Hyphenation is the process of splitting words into syllables and inserting hyphens between them to facilitate the reading of a text. It is also used to divide words when the word cannot fit on a line.

This technique is particularly helpful in fully justified texts, where it aids in creating a uniform edge along both sides of a paragraph. Hyphenation rules vary among languages and even among different publications within the same language. It's a critical component in typesetting, significantly influencing the aesthetics and readability of printed and digital media. For instance, in compound adjectives like 'long-term solution', hyphens clarify relationships between words, preventing misinterpretation. Moreover, hyphenation can alter meanings: 'recreation' differs from 're-creation'.

With the advent of digital text, hyphenation algorithms have become more sophisticated, though still imperfect, sometimes requiring manual adjustment to ensure accuracy and coherence in text layout. Understanding and correctly applying hyphenation rules is therefore not only a matter of linguistic accuracy but also a key aspect of effective visual communication.
